Rod Thrailkill, P.E.
Rod
Thrailkill, P.E.
EDUCATION
University of Missouri - Columbia, BS CE, 1981
REGISTRATION
Professional Engineer, State of Texas, 1986 #60453
PROFESSIONAL HISTORY
Chica & Associates, Inc., Beaumont, Texas; 2000 Vice
President - Engineering
Directs the firm's engineering assignments, which specialize
in the design of roadway and transportation improvement projects,
drainage improvement projects, and water and sewer improvement
projects. These assignments include transportation systems
planning, environmental studies, schematic development, roadway
design, bridge design, traffic engineering studies, traffic
operations design, hydraulic design and analysis, scour studies,
and foundation studies for new alignment, added capacity,
reconstruction, bridge replacement, and rehabilitation projects
for highways and freeways.
Texas Department of Transportation, Liberty, Texas; 1981-2000
Assistant Area Engineer
Mr. Thrailkill has over 18 years of experience with TxDOT
in the design, construction, and maintenance of highways and
bridges, with 14 years of experience as Assistant Area Engineer
for the Liberty Area office. During this time he provided
project management for the design and construction of projects
in Liberty and Chambers Counties. This experience includes
all phases of project development from preliminary engineering
through construction: Preparation of environmental documents
for nationwide, individual permits, and environmental assessments;
route studies and schematic design; pavement design; bridge
layouts; roadway design; traffic engineering studies; signing
and pavement marking; hydrologic studies; hydraulic design;
roadway construction management and inspection; and transportation
foundation studies. Projects included:
Project Manager for completing schematics, environmental
assessments (FONSI), public meetings and preliminary drainage
studies. IH-10 (1987), US 59 (1991), US 90 (1993), SH 105
(1995), FM 1409 (1997), FM 787 (1999), and FM 365 (2002).
Project Manager for preparing PS&E for reconstructing
and upgrading facilities to current standards. Work included
obtaining permits, pavement designs, bridge layout sheets,
hydrologic and hydraulic design, bridge scour analysis,
traffic control plans, construction sequences, utility adjustments,
signing and pavement markings. FM 1942 (1990), US 90 (1992),
SH 146 (1997), IH-10 (1997), FM 1409 (1997), US 90 (1998),
SH 146 (1999), FM 365 (2002), and US 69 (2003).
Project Manager for developing PS&E for bridge replacement
projects. Work included replacing and widening approaches,
pavement design, permitting, bridge layouts, hydrologic
and hydraulic studies, scour analysis, traffic control plans,
construction sequences, signing and pavement markings. IH-10
at Old and Lost Rivers (1990), SH 146 at UPRR Overpass (1992),
US 59 at East Fork San Jacinto River (1997), and over 12
off-system bridges at various locations in Chambers, Liberty,
and Fisher Counties.
